For the 2026 school year, there are 10 public high schools serving 8,238 students in 85212, AZ.
The top-ranked public high schools in 85212, AZ are Basis Mesa, Asu Preparatory Academy-polytechnic High School and Eastmark High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high schools in zipcode 85212 have an average math proficiency score of 48% (versus the Arizona public high school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 55% (versus the 45% statewide average). High schools in 85212, AZ have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Arizona public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 85212 have a Graduation Rate of 89%, which is more than the Arizona average of 78%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Asu Preparatory Academy-polytechnic High School, with ≥95%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Arizona or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 41%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arizona public high school average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
